By this Civil Application, Applicant is seeking stay of the operation and implementation of the judgment and award dated 18.7.2018 passed by MACT, Pune in MACP No.10 of 2016 holding that Respondent original Claimants are entitled a sum of Rs.39,10,000/- by way of compensation along 1/3
with interest @ 7% p.a.
The learned counsel for the Applicant submits that Respondent original Claimant filed Execution Application for recovery of entire amount. He submits that they received notice in Darkhast Application No.150 of 2018 He further submits that Applicants are ready and willing to deposit entire awarded amount on or before 31.5.2019. Statement is accepted. In the present proceeding, in an accident which occurred on 19.11.2014 Claimant no.1 lost her husband. Considering the reason given by Trial Court, I am of the opinion that Claimants are entitled to withdraw some amount without furnishing any security as there is a delay on the part of Insurance Company to file the present First Appeal before this court. Not only that, claimants filed execution application for recovery of amount. Hence, following order is passed A.
Civil Application is allowed in terms of prayer clause (a) on condition that Applicant to deposit entire awarded amount along with interest in the Tribunal on or before 31.5.2019, failing which Civil Application shall stand dismissed without referring back to the court. "(a) That this Hon'ble Court be pleased to 2/3
stay the effect/execution/operation and implementation of the impugned Judgment and Award dated 18.07.2018 passed in M.A.C.T. Application No.10 of 2016 by Shri DILIP MURUMKAR - Additional Member, MACT Pune, @ PUNE."
B.
If amount is deposited within stipulated time as stated hereinabove, Claimant no.1, Nita Rohidas Pathare is entitled to withdraw 25% amount and Claimant no.4, Sakhubai Dattatray Pathare 10% amount but subject to outcome of the First Appeal.
C.
Tribunal is directed to invest remaining awarded amount in fixed deposit of any nationalised bank initially for a period of one year and same to be continued till further orders.
D.
Liberty granted to the Claimant to make Application for withdrawal of amount, if they so desire, and that Application be decided on its own merits.
E.
Civil application stands disposed of accordingly.
